"🏦 QE/QT and crypto While the market keeps bleeding red I want to highlight an interesting angle that helps make sense of the bigger picture Two abbreviations matter here: QE (Quantitative Easing) the money printer: asset purchases and liquidity injections. QT (Quantitative Tightening) contraction the Fed shrinking its balance sheet and pulling money out of the economy. QE and QT are simply the Fed and FOMC reacting to macro conditions. When there is not enough liquidity they add it. When there is too much they drain it. And for crypto this used to work almost perfectly in sync: QE = more"

"I finally had a few spare hours to dig into Pierre Rochards argument the one claiming Bitcoins security budget doesnt have a problem. Thanks to @Green_Giant_Mo for the pointer. It was dense reading (a lot of comments) but heres the core idea as I understood it 🔵 Pierre argues that Bitcoins security budget isnt a fixed pool of money. Its a market mechanism that makes an attack expensive only once it begins. How does that supposedly work If an attack is underway fees rise automatically. The recipient wants fast settlement the sender bumps the fee miners chase higher revenue and everyone piles"

"The problem is that under the current setup Bitcoin loses in almost every scenario. If Bitcoins price doesnt rise aggressively well see waves of small miners shutting down because they cant stay profitable. That funnels hashrate into the top X pools and accelerates centralisation. But if Bitcoin does 2x every halving miners will be fine yet the network becomes more attractive to attack. The gap between the security budget and the potential payoff from a XX% attack widens. (And before we get lost in who would do this debates - Im talking about political and reputational attacks not financially"
